I find that the 'casual office' dress policy usually see's girls wearing lots of tops, blouses, shirts, pants and jeans. We often forget about the humble little dress. The little dress can save you so much time in the morning as you won't have to match a top and bottom.
A fab little dress can be dressed down with a cardigan and flats or dressed up with a jacket/ blazer and heels. It can even get you from day to night, even from weekdays to weekends. So versatile. Looking at your photo, you have gorgeous curves. Try a wrap dress, they are super easy to wear and fabulous on curves. Look for one in a good quality jersey fabric. Not only will it drape on your perfectly, but no need to iron them.
In terms of stores try: Portmans, Events, Cue, Shieke, Glassons, Veronika Maine. The new Stella McCartney range for Target also has some great pieces.
